**Action item (from the Marrowtide API incident):** fix pagination docs and guardrails.

Quick recap for support: a few integrators were looping on `page` forever because we silently capped results at 10k, so their syncs looked "stuck." We're adding an explicit cursor-based mode and a clear error when the cap is hit, targeted for next sprint. Until then, if a customer reports an endless or stalled sync, point them at cursor pagination instead of offsets. The workaround writeup and rollout status are tracked here.

operations page: https://jenkins.zemvarcloud.local/job/merge_requests/repo/build/73930b4b30f0a8ed

The CrashFunnel ingest workers pull symbolicated reports from the Tarn queue every two minutes. Retention is 30 days; scrubbing of device fields happens at ingest, not at query time, so please verify the scrub rules before approving the new payload schema. The dedup index rebuilds nightly and briefly holds raw stacks in the staging bucket — that window is the main exposure you should assess. To access the sealed review vault during your audit, use the recovery passphrase below:

vault phrase of faduf-bajep = tamius-rusox-holok-kasdor-rusdor-druius-giliel-ulaox-zoriel

Validator plugins in Quillgate load at startup from the plugins directory and register against the schema registry. Reviewers should confirm each plugin declares its supported data types and a version pin; unpinned plugins are rejected in strict mode. The loader reads its behavior entirely from the service config, reproduced below for reference.

config for kafof-bawef:
holath:
  log_level: debug
  metrics_host: metrics.holath.qorvelsys.internal
  pin: 2191
  pool_size: 32

Subject: Tollbrook Term Sheet — Board Review

Board,

Tollbrook Dynamics delivered their term sheet Friday. Headline: minority stake, board observer seat, exclusivity in the Averlane market for three years. Valuation is acceptable; exclusivity clause is not. Counsel is drafting a counter. We need board sign-off before Thursday's call. The confidential negotiating position is set out below.

confidential, yajof-fawep: The renewal with Quenaelax Holdings closes at $20 million a year, 20 percent above the last contract. Project Holix slips by two quarters because of the staffing delay.